AI-Powered Education Revolution
Artificial Intelligence is reshaping the educational landscape, offering personalized learning experiences and innovative teaching methods. This section explores how AI is transforming education, its applications and trends, and the ethical considerations surrounding its use in educational technology.
Transforming Learning with AI
AI is revolutionizing the way we learn by providing personalized, adaptive learning experiences. Machine learning algorithms analyze student performance data to tailor content and pacing to individual needs, ensuring that each learner receives targeted support.
Intelligent tutoring systems leverage natural language processing to offer real-time feedback and guidance, simulating one-on-one instruction. These AI-powered tutors can work tirelessly, providing students with round-the-clock support and opportunities for practice.
Virtual and augmented reality technologies, enhanced by AI, create immersive learning environments that bring abstract concepts to life. From exploring historical events to conducting virtual science experiments, these technologies offer engaging, hands-on learning experiences that were previously impossible.
AI Applications and Trends in Education
AI-powered chatbots are becoming increasingly prevalent in educational settings, offering instant support for administrative queries and basic academic assistance. These digital assistants free up valuable time for educators to focus on more complex teaching tasks.
Automated grading systems are streamlining assessment processes, particularly for objective questions and standardized tests. Natural language processing is even being applied to evaluate written responses, providing rapid feedback on essays and short-answer questions.
Predictive analytics are helping institutions identify at-risk students early, enabling timely interventions. By analyzing patterns in attendance, engagement, and performance data, AI systems can flag potential issues before they escalate, supporting student retention efforts.
AI Ethics in Educational Technology
As AI becomes more integrated into education, ethical considerations are paramount. Privacy concerns arise from the collection and analysis of vast amounts of student data, necessitating robust data protection measures and transparent policies.
The potential for bias in AI algorithms is a significant concern, as these systems may perpetuate or exacerbate existing inequalities in education. Ensuring diverse and representative training data is crucial to mitigate this risk.
There's also the question of maintaining human connection in learning. While AI can enhance education, it's essential to strike a balance, preserving the irreplaceable role of human teachers in nurturing creativity, critical thinking, and social-emotional skills.
Meta's Breakthrough in Brain Activity
Meta's recent advancements in decoding brain activity represent a significant leap in neurotechnology and AI. This section examines the implications of this breakthrough, its potential applications in healthcare, and the ethical considerations surrounding such powerful technology.
Decoding Language from Brain Signals
Meta's researchers have achieved a remarkable feat in decoding language directly from brain activity. This breakthrough involves using AI to interpret neural signals and reconstruct speech, opening up new possibilities for communication and understanding human cognition.
The technology employs advanced machine learning algorithms to analyze patterns in brain activity, correlating these patterns with specific words and phrases. This process allows for the reconstruction of language from thought alone, potentially giving voice to those who have lost the ability to speak.
While still in its early stages, this research holds immense promise for developing brain-computer interfaces that could revolutionize how we interact with technology and assist individuals with neurological disorders.
AI in Healthcare: Implications and Innovations
Meta's breakthrough in decoding brain activity has far-reaching implications for healthcare. This technology could lead to more effective treatments for neurological disorders, enabling precise diagnosis and personalized interventions based on individual brain patterns.
In rehabilitation, AI-powered brain-computer interfaces could help patients regain motor control or communicate after severe injuries. For individuals with conditions like ALS or locked-in syndrome, this technology offers hope for restored communication and improved quality of life.
Beyond direct applications, this research contributes to our understanding of brain function, potentially accelerating discoveries in neuroscience and cognitive psychology. As AI continues to unlock the mysteries of the brain, we may see transformative advances in mental health treatment and cognitive enhancement.
Ethical Considerations in AI Breakthroughs
The ability to decode thoughts raises significant ethical questions. Privacy concerns are paramount, as this technology could potentially access our most intimate thoughts and memories. Robust safeguards and clear guidelines for consent and data use are essential.
There's also the question of cognitive liberty – the right to control one's own mental processes. As brain-computer interfaces become more sophisticated, society must grapple with issues of mental autonomy and the potential for external manipulation of thought.
The equitable distribution of these technologies is another crucial consideration. Ensuring that advancements in neurotechnology benefit all of society, rather than exacerbating existing inequalities, will be a significant challenge as these innovations progress.

AI Breakthroughs in Everyday Life
AI is rapidly becoming an integral part of our daily routines, often in ways we hardly notice. From smart home devices that learn our preferences to personalized content recommendations on streaming platforms, AI is enhancing our everyday experiences.
In transportation, AI is powering advancements in autonomous vehicles and traffic management systems, promising safer and more efficient travel. Natural language processing is improving voice assistants and translation services, breaking down language barriers and facilitating global communication.
AI-driven predictive maintenance is increasing the reliability of our devices and infrastructure, while computer vision technologies are enhancing security systems and enabling new augmented reality experiences.
AI Trends Shaping Business Growth
Businesses across industries are leveraging AI to drive innovation and efficiency. Machine learning algorithms are optimizing supply chains, predicting market trends, and personalizing customer experiences at scale.
In finance, AI is revolutionizing risk assessment and fraud detection, while in healthcare, it's accelerating drug discovery and improving diagnostic accuracy. The manufacturing sector is embracing AI-powered robotics and predictive maintenance to increase productivity and reduce downtime.
As AI becomes more accessible through cloud services and pre-trained models, even small businesses can harness its power to compete in the global marketplace.
Encouraging AI Adoption in Industries
Despite the clear benefits, many industries still face challenges in adopting AI. Overcoming resistance to change and addressing skill gaps are crucial for successful AI integration.
Education and training programs are essential to prepare the workforce for an AI-driven future. Collaborations between academia, industry, and government can help develop curricula that equip students and professionals with the necessary skills.
Creating a culture of innovation and experimentation within organizations can encourage AI adoption. Starting with small, high-impact projects can demonstrate the value of AI and build momentum for larger-scale implementations.
